Hawks Open Play at Myrtle Beach Intercollegiate

Virginia Lane is tied for 5th place after Monday's opening round.
MYRTLE BEACH, SC- The Chowan University women's golf team opened play at the Myrtle Beach Intercollegiate on Monday afternoon.  Gaby Rivera-Garcia, L'leah Laing, and Virginia Lane competed for the Hawks at the Lion's Paw Course at Ocean Ridge Plantation.  The trio will play in the final round on Tuesday.

Lane led the effort for the Hawks on the opening day of play.  She carded a 75 on Monday and stands tied for fifth in the field of 91.  Rivera-Garcia shot an 87 for Chowan.  She concluded the first round in a five-way tied for 68th.  Laing carded a 100 in the opening round and is in 87th place individually.

Maria Torres of the University of West Georgia leads the field.  She holds a three-stroke lead after shooting a 70 on Monday.  The Wolves also stand in first place as a team after combining for a team score of 299.
